Your search returned 1703 results.
National Library of Wales
Davies, Hanlyn
© Davies, Hanlyn/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Harries, Hywel
© Harries, Hywel/The National Library of Wales
National Library of Wales
Davies, Hanlyn
© Davies, Hanlyn/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Chamberlain, Brenda
© Chamberlain, Brenda/The National Library of Wales
National Library of Wales
Chamberlain, Brenda
© Chamberlain, Brenda/The National Library of Wales
National Library of Wales
Roberts, Will
© Roberts, Will/The National Library of Wales
National Library of Wales
Edwards, John Uzzell
© Edwards, John Uzzell/The National Library of Wales
National Library of Wales
Hayes, Maria
© Hayes, Maria/The National Library of Wales
National Library of Wales
Sheppard, Maurice
© Sheppard, Maurice/The National Library of Wales
National Library of Wales
Sheppard, Maurice
© Sheppard, Maurice/The National Library of Wales